Monday Evening Musical Club presents ‘Hooked on Tonics’
NORWICH – The Monday Evening Musical Club of Norwich opens its 2012-13 season on Monday, Sept. 10 with the return of ‘Hooked on Tonics,’ SUNY Oneonta’s premiere A Cappella group. The group performs on campus as well as around the Oneonta area throughout the year. Hooked on Tonics (HOT) performs a variety of styles of music, from classical to contemporary. The purpose is to provide students with the opportunity to sing in an a cappella group and to expose the college campus to this genre of music. Hooked on Tonics also provides students with the opportunity to arrange popular songs for a singing group, to musically direct a singing group, to coordinate and book performances, become familiar with microphones and equipment, and to record their music for the campus community to enjoy.
Music Club is pleased to welcome them back after last year’s performance. The program will be held at United Church of Christ, 11 W. Main Street in Norwich and will begin at 7:30 p.m. It is free and open to the public, as are all Monday Evening Musical Club concerts. The club accepts free will donations, which go directly into its scholarship fund. Scholarships are awarded to Chenango County high school seniors who pursue a music major in college, and have been given every year since 1954.
